The honesty, commitment, and sacrifice of Cuban athletes was recognized in a ceremony held in Havana’s Ciudad Deportiva, during which bronze medals were presented to weightlifters Yordanis Borrero and Jadier Valladares from their participation in the Beijing 2008 Olympic Games, as well as an Olympic Diploma to wrestler Roberto Monzón

Cuba has one of two Latin American facilities accredited by the World Anti-Doping Agency and the International Olympic Committee to test athletes, the other is in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il
